项目管理软件软件研发怎么做才能高效落地并提升团队协作效率?
在数字化转型加速的今天,项目管理软件已成为企业提升运营效率、优化资源配置和加强跨部门协同的核心工具。然而,许多企业在推进项目管理软件研发过程中面临需求模糊、开发周期长、上线后使用率低等问题。那么,项目管理软件软件研发到底该如何科学规划与执行,才能真正实现高效落地,并显著提升团队协作效率?本文将从战略定位、核心功能设计、技术架构选择、敏捷开发实践、用户反馈闭环及持续迭代六大维度深入剖析,为企业提供一套可落地的项目管理软件研发方法论。
一、明确战略目标:为什么要做这个项目管理软件?
任何成功的软件研发都始于清晰的战略意图。企业在启动项目管理软件研发前,必须回答三个关键问题:
- 痛点是什么? 是任务分配混乱、进度跟踪困难、资源浪费严重,还是多团队沟通成本高?通过调研现有流程中的瓶颈,识别出最迫切需要解决的问题。
- 期望达成什么价值? 是提高项目交付准时率、缩短平均开发周期、降低人力成本,还是增强客户满意度?量化目标有助于后续评估效果。
- 谁是主要使用者? 是项目经理、开发人员、产品经理还是高层管理者?不同角色对功能的需求差异极大,需分层设计权限与界面。
例如,某科技公司发现其研发团队每月因需求变更频繁导致返工率达30%,于是决定打造一款集成需求管理、任务拆解与进度可视化的一体化项目管理平台。该目标明确指向“减少无效沟通”,为后续功能设计提供了坚实基础。
二、核心功能模块设计:满足真实场景的最小可行产品(MVP)
项目管理软件的功能不应追求大而全,而应聚焦于高频刚需场景,构建最小可行产品(MVP)。以下是建议的核心模块:
- 任务管理: 支持看板、甘特图、列表视图三种模式切换,支持优先级标记、截止日期提醒、子任务分解等基础功能。
- 进度追踪: 自动记录工时消耗,生成燃尽图或里程碑完成度报告,帮助项目经理实时掌握项目健康状态。
- 文档与知识沉淀: 内嵌文档协作(如Markdown编辑器)、附件上传、版本控制,避免信息孤岛。
- 沟通整合: 集成即时消息(类似钉钉/飞书API),在任务卡片下直接评论,减少跳转成本。
- 报表分析: 提供项目概览、个人绩效、团队产能等多维度数据仪表盘,助力决策层快速洞察。
值得注意的是,初期不必一次性覆盖所有功能。比如,可以先上线任务+进度追踪两个模块,让核心用户群体试用并收集反馈,再逐步扩展至其他模块。这种渐进式策略既能降低风险,又能确保产品始终贴近用户真实需求。
三、技术架构选型:稳定可靠且具备扩展性的底层支撑
项目管理软件作为长期运维系统,其技术栈的选择直接影响未来三年甚至五年的维护成本与演进空间。推荐采用如下架构:
- 前端: React/Vue.js + TypeScript,保证组件复用性和类型安全;搭配Ant Design或Element Plus等成熟UI框架提升开发效率。
- 后端: Spring Boot(Java)或 NestJS(Node.js)构建微服务架构,便于按业务模块独立部署与扩展。
- 数据库: PostgreSQL为主,适合复杂查询;Redis用于缓存热点数据(如用户权限、项目状态);Elasticsearch用于全文搜索(如任务描述关键词匹配)。
- 部署方式: Docker容器化 + Kubernetes集群管理,实现自动化部署、弹性扩缩容,适应突发流量高峰。
此外,还需考虑安全性与合规性:强制启用HTTPS加密传输、敏感字段加密存储(如密码、API密钥)、定期进行渗透测试与漏洞扫描,确保符合GDPR或国内《网络安全法》要求。
四、敏捷开发实践:小步快跑,快速验证市场反应
传统的瀑布模型已难以应对快速变化的市场需求。建议采用Scrum或Kanban等敏捷开发模式,每2周为一个迭代周期(Sprint),每次交付可运行的功能版本。
具体做法包括:
- 用户故事地图(User Story Mapping): 将功能按用户旅程组织,优先排序,确保每个迭代都有明确价值产出。
- 每日站会(Daily Standup): 团队成员同步进展、障碍与计划,保持信息透明。
- 迭代评审(Sprint Review): 向内部用户展示成果,获取即时反馈,调整下一阶段方向。
- 回顾会议(Retrospective): 持续改进流程,例如减少会议冗余时间、优化代码审查机制。
某初创公司在第一轮迭代中仅实现了任务创建与分配功能,但通过内部试点发现“无法查看他人任务”成为最大痛点,因此在第二轮迅速增加了“项目看板”模块,极大提升了协作体验。这正是敏捷开发的优势——快速试错、及时修正。
五、用户反馈闭环:从被动响应到主动参与
很多项目管理软件失败的根本原因在于“开发者闭门造车”。要打破这一魔咒,必须建立有效的用户反馈机制:
- 内置反馈入口: 在每个页面角落添加“反馈按钮”,引导用户点击提交建议或报告Bug。
- 设立种子用户群: 从各部门挑选有影响力的员工组成早期测试小组,给予专属账号与奖励机制(如积分兑换礼品)。
- 定期问卷调研: 每月发送结构化问卷,了解使用频率、满意度评分、改进建议等指标。
- 数据分析驱动: 利用埋点技术统计各功能点击率、停留时长、转化路径,找出冷门功能或卡点环节。
例如,一家制造企业发现“甘特图”模块日均使用次数仅为5次,而“任务列表”超过50次,说明多数人更偏好简洁直观的操作方式。据此,他们将甘特图优化为可折叠状态,默认显示列表,显著提高了整体可用性。
六、持续迭代与生态建设:让项目管理软件成为组织能力的一部分
项目管理软件不是一次性项目,而是需要长期运营的数字资产。后期应重点做好以下工作:
- 版本发布节奏: 每季度发布一次大版本更新,包含重大功能升级;每月推送小补丁修复常见问题。
- 插件与API开放: 允许第三方开发者接入Jira、GitLab、Slack等主流工具,打造开放生态。
- 培训与文化建设: 组织线上培训课程、制作操作手册、设立“最佳实践案例分享日”,培养用户习惯。
- 绩效挂钩: 将项目管理软件使用情况纳入团队考核指标,如任务按时完成率、文档完整度等,推动全员参与。
最终目标是让项目管理软件不再只是工具,而是融入组织文化、赋能每位员工的生产力引擎。
结语:项目管理软件研发是一场系统工程
从战略出发、以用户为中心、靠技术打底、借敏捷提速、凭反馈迭代,才能打造出真正有价值的项目管理软件。它不仅是代码堆砌的结果,更是组织治理能力现代化的体现。只有当软件与人的行为产生良性互动,才能实现“高效落地”与“协作提升”的双重目标。





